I used to be the ultimate ChatGPT hater, and I've now found a few really helpful use cases for it. In this episode, I describe how I don't find ChatGPT useful for actual translation or writing, but I do find it helpful for interpreting prep, jazzing up presentation titles, complicated research questions, and other tasks like complying with specific character counts and tone.
